### AuthorTopic: Trying to isolate a problem with mods in new 4.09 update  (Read 185 times)

#### WxTech

##### Trying to isolate a problem with mods in new 4.09 update
« on: June 29, 2019, 12:12:36 AM »

Have been adding the last of the 4.08 mods into my 4.09 game. After nailing down a number of errors, this one has me stumped.

The CTD occurs presumably at the instant of the loading status changing from 60% to 70% (I don't actually see 70% appear, but the CTD occurs after the 60% indicator has been showing for the typical ~12 seconds.)

The last bit of log.lst, where the class '4.09' is a mystery. All flight models appear to have loaded successfully...

Code: [Select]
[5:54:50] s1 = flightmodels/ju-87g-2(ofrudel).fmd[5:54:50] s = FlightModels/Ju-87G-2(ofRudel).fmd[5:54:50] m_lastFMFile = gui/game/buttons[5:54:50] sFMDir = gui/game/buttons[5:54:50] s1 = flightmodels/me-262(ofnowotny).fmd[5:54:50] s = FlightModels/Me-262(ofNowotny).fmd[5:54:50] m_lastFMFile = gui/game/buttons[5:54:50] Main begin: PlMisAir: class '4.09' not found[5:54:50] java.lang.RuntimeException: PlMisAir: class '4.09' not found[5:54:50] at com.maddox.il2.gui.GUIQuick.fillArrayPlanes(GUIQuick.java:1167)[5:54:50] at com.maddox.il2.gui.GUIQuick.<init>(GUIQuick.java:1243)[5:54:50] at com.maddox.il2.gui.GUI.create(GUI.java:158)[5:54:50] at com.maddox.il2.game.Main3D.beginApp(Main3D.java:1845)[5:54:50] at com.maddox.il2.game.Main3D.beginApp(Main3D.java:1544)[5:54:50] at com.maddox.il2.game.MainWin3D.beginApp(MainWin3D.java:211)[5:54:50] at com.maddox.il2.game.Main.exec(Main.java:419)[5:54:50] at com.maddox.il2.game.GameWin3D.main(GameWin3D.java:235)[29.06.2019 5:54:50] -------------- END log session -------------
Any pointers, oh brain trust?
#### SAS~Storebror

##### Re: Trying to isolate a problem with mods in new 4.09 update
« Reply #1 on: June 29, 2019, 12:24:29 AM »

"fillArrayPlanes" method parses air.ini file, so apparently your air.ini contains a line with that fancy "4.09" plane entry.

Mike
#### WxTech

##### Re: Trying to isolate a problem with mods in new 4.09 update
« Reply #2 on: June 29, 2019, 03:07:42 AM »

Mike,
I scrutinized air.ini very carefully before posting, and didn't catch anything untoward. Or so I thought! Your reply inspired me to look more closely, before retiring for the night.

And I almost literally slapped my forehead after a few seconds' look. It was in the new 'header' sections I created in air.ini, to group the new 4.09 planes. The offending lines looked like this one:

*______New 4.09 Allied_____* air.Placeholder

It should look like this:

*______New_4.09_Allied_____* air.Placeholder

It was the darned spaces, which resulted in the "4.09" being parsed as the flight model name.

Live and learn. Your tip really shortened my agony; I appreciate it!

Anyhoo, after that fix she loaded up just fine. And because I couldn't use the new buttons until now and hence was playing with old flight models, I now note some not small differences in the handling of some birds I've flown a lot over the years. Kind of like a bit of a new game.
